Eagles not in market for safety

Philadelphia Eagles coach Chip Kelly has insisted that the franchise is not in the market to acquire a safety ahead of the trade deadline.

Speculation earlier this week had suggested that Philadelphia were looking to add depth ahead of the deadline on Tuesday evening.

"A lot of times, the people who float that are the people who want their safeties picked up," Kelly said, according to the Philadelphia Inquirer.

"I may look into that, but we're not actively looking to upgrade anything."

Kelly instead praised the play of both Nate Allen and Malcolm Jenkins, adding that the trade deadline in the NFL is a "little bit overblown".
